How much do weekend electroplating process engineer jobs pay per year?

As of Jul 19, 2026, the average yearly pay for weekend electroplating process engineer in Phoenix, AZ is $91,365.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$74,000.00 and $102,300.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is the difference between Weekend Electroplating Process Engineer vs Weekend Electroplating Technician?

AspectWeekend Electroplating Process EngineerWeekend Electroplating Technician
ResponsibilitiesDesigns, develops, and optimizes electroplating processes, ensuring quality and efficiency.Performs electroplating tasks, maintains equipment, and follows established procedures.
Required CredentialsTypically requires a degree in engineering or related field; certifications are a plus.High school diploma or equivalent; technical training or certifications preferred.
Work EnvironmentLaboratories, manufacturing plants, or research facilities, often involving process oversight.Production floors, electroplating stations, and maintenance areas.

The main difference between a Weekend Electroplating Process Engineer and a Weekend Electroplating Technician lies in their roles. The engineer focuses on process development and optimization, requiring technical education, while the technician handles hands-on tasks and equipment maintenance. Both roles are essential in electroplating operations but differ in responsibilities and qualifications.

We're looking to hire a highly motivated mechanical engineer to join Advanced Packaging Mechanical Analysis team located in Chandler AZ. This role is focused on developing Multiphysics thermo-mechanical simulations to support design, definition, development and qualifications of advanced semiconductor packaging led by Intel Foundry. This position offers the opportunity to work at the forefront of semiconductor packaging innovation, collaborating with engineers and researchers across multiple business groups such as design, technology integration, reliability, yield and manufacturing.
This role requires regular onsite presence to fulfill essential job responsibilities.
Key Responsibilities.
  • Develop and validate finite element analysis (FEA) models to simulate thermal and mechanical behavior of advanced semiconductor packages. Perform simulations to evaluate stress, strain, warpage, delamination, thermal cycling, and reliability risks across a wide range of package architectures.
  • Collaborate with cross-functional teams to define simulation requirements, interpret results, and provide actionable design and process recommendations. Design and coordinate lab tests and research on basic materials and properties to understand material behavior and reliability failure mechanisms.
  • The ideal candidate will have to drive strategic development activities and work closely with internal and external customer organizations to plan, execute and communicate development activities and programs.
  • The team leverages both experimental and numerical methods across a broad range of areas, including thermal, mechanical, and fluids.
  • The team typically uses a combination of simulations and experiments, as needed, to help solve practical engineering problems.
  • The team frequently leverages advanced analysis methods (statistical, AI/ML) to supplement modeling and experimental approaches.

Minimum Qualifications:
  • PhD Degree in Mechanical Engineering, Chemical Engineering or Material Sciences or a related field with emphasis in solid mechanics.
  • 3+ years of Thermal-mechanical work/research experience with emphasis on silicon reliability
  • 3+ years of experience with Finite Element Analysis tools
  • 3+ years of experience with experimental material characterization metrologies such as DMA/TMA and nano-indentation.

Preferred Qualifications:
  • Experience with multi-physics simulations, including coupled electro-thermal-mechanical analysis, free surface two phase flows, electroplating and plasma.
  • Experience with co-packaging optics, optical coupling, fiber pigtail attachment, free space optics.
  • Experience with designing, planning and executing experiments, along with interpretation of results.
  • Experience with scripting and automation (e.g., Python, TCL, MATLAB) to streamline simulation workflows.
  • Knowledge in advanced packaging technologies, familiarity with semiconductor packaging processes, including die attach, underfill, molding, bumping, surface mount and reflow.
  • Programming/script development with artificial intelligence and machine learning concepts.
  • Previous related work experience in a semiconductor foundry preferred.
